These ten stories offer a stunning vision of contemporary American suburbia, littered with tension, heartbreak and revelations. They take readers across the country - from rural Pennsylvania to Southern California to the quiet streets of Connecticut. At the heart of each story, characters struggle to find meaning in their daily lives.

The Thirty-Nine Stepsis the original spy thriller and the inspiration for countless books, films and games.Adventurer Richard Hannay is bored with life, but after an encounter with an American who informs him of an assassination plot and is then promptly murdered in Hannays London flat, he becomes the suspect and is forced to go on the run.
